WebApr 12, 2024 · A pump curve is a graphical representation of a centrifugal pump’s performance characteristics. It shows the relationship between the flow rate (Q), head (H), and power consumption (P) of a pump at different operating points. The pump curve is generated by testing the pump in a laboratory and plotting the data on a graph.
